What's the difference between a home equity loan and a HELOC?
A home equity loan funds as one lump sum at a fixed rate. A HELOC is a line of credit you draw from as needed, often with a variable rate. Choose a HELOAN for predictable payments.

A cash-out refinance replaces your entire first mortgage and resets the clock on your loan term. A home equity loan leaves your first mortgage alone and sits on top of it as a second lien.
If your first mortgage rate is low, a home equity loan keeps that rate in place. A refi would lock in the current rate on the full balance, which may cost more over time.
